St. Philip the Apostle School Class of 2026 Catalina Island Trip



The Class of 2026 from St. Philip the Apostle School recently embarked on their unforgettable Catalina Island trip—a cherished tradition filled with adventure, learning, and bonding. Students enjoyed hands-on marine science activities, team-building challenges, and plenty of fun in the sun as they explored the natural beauty of the island. This special experience marks a meaningful milestone in their final year at St. Philip’s.
